北美安全存取服務邊際市場規模預計在 2025 年為 116.3 億美元,預計到 2030 年將達到 290.8 億美元,預測期內(2025-2030 年)的複合年成長率為 20.12%。

北美安全存取服務邊緣市場-IMG1

隨著 SASE 變得越來越普及,對有資格部署、管理和支援 SASE 解決方案的人才的需求也越來越大。因此,供應商和獨立組織提供的培訓和認證計劃數量不斷增加。為了有效部署和使用這些技術,IT 團隊專注於取得 SASE 功能。

關鍵亮點

  • SASE 透過在整個網路上實施統一的安全標準和加密來幫助企業滿足嚴格的合規性要求。在傳輸過程中和儲存在雲端應用程式中的資料保護有助於最大限度地減少法規不合規和相關罰款的可能性。例如,醫療保健組織必須遵守嚴格的監管標準來保護病患資料。
  • 由於缺乏足夠的安全通訊協定和技術,強烈建議使用 SASE。對於應對日益擴大的威脅、遠距工作挑戰、雲端遷移和合規性要求的組織來說,像 SASE 這樣全面、適應性強的安全解決方案變得越來越必要。它不僅將解決這些緊迫的安全問題,還將解決網路安全人才短缺的問題,並確保在面對現代威脅和挑戰時的可擴展性、業務永續營運連續性和彈性。
  • 資料隱私和法規合規要求是推動 SASE 業務成長的強大力量。企業意識到需要像 SASE 這樣的完整安全解決方案來遵守嚴格的資料隱私法規、避免處罰並保護其品牌。隨著隱私法的不斷發展和在國際上的傳播,對 SASE 作為確保合規性的工具的需求預計將持續成長,使其成為現代網路安全和資料保護工作的重要組成部分。
  • 受技術進步和消費者對雲端的偏好日益增加的推動,對雲端基礎的解決方案的需求正在蓬勃發展。技術使用戶能夠從遠端位置存取資料。企業越來越意識到將資料遷移到雲端比維護內部部署基礎架構更節省成本和資源,這推動了對雲端基礎的解決方案的需求。
  • 隨著數位轉型工作的快速推進,COVID-19 疫情加速了企業對 SASE 的採用。隨著網路融合不斷加速雲端運算的採用,安全性對於更好地支援日益增加的遠端和行動勞動力至關重要。
  • 2023 年 3 月,致力於推動網路和安全整合的全球網路安全公司 Fortinet 宣布對其單一供應商 SASE 解決方案 FortiSASE 進行多項增強,為 SaaS、私人應用程式和網際網路上的數位資源提供更大的部署靈活性和新的安全存取功能。

北美安全存取服務邊際市場趨勢

IT 和通訊終端用戶產業預計將佔據主要市場佔有率

  • 北美,特別是美國,往往是 IT 和電訊領域主要企業的所在地。該地區擁有強勁的通訊產業、眾多的科技公司和對IT基礎設施的大量投資。例如,美國IT基礎設施服務供應商 Kyndryl 於 2023 年 5 月宣布推出由 Fortinet 支援的託管安全存取服務邊際(SASE) 解決方案。該解決方案將 Kyndryl 的網路和保全服務與 Fortinet 的雲端交付安全和安全網路解決方案結合,為各行各業的客戶設計、建置、維護和升級關鍵任務網路。這些努力促使 SASE 解決方案在 IT 和電訊終端用戶領域廣泛採用。
  • 此外,網路即服務 (NaaS) 對於 IT 和電訊組織至關重要,因為它提供了無縫通訊、資料傳輸和雲端連接所需的網路基礎設施。這些組織嚴重依賴強大、可擴展的網路解決方案。例如,2023 年 7 月,美國電信業者Lumen Technologies 宣布了其網路即服務 (NaaS) 平台的旗艦功能,這是其轉型通訊產業計畫的一部分。 Lumen 透過為消費者提供購買、使用和管理網路服務的彈性,將傳統電訊轉移到雲端。
  • 總體而言,SASE 市場中 IT 和通訊終端用戶垂直領域的成長受到該領域獨特的網路安全需求、安全遠端存取需求、安全通訊服務以及數位轉型和雲端採用的更廣泛趨勢的推動。
  • 5G突破性的延遲、吞吐量和可靠性能力將支援新的工業、商業和消費者服務。 5G 可能會鼓勵全球 SASE 供應商更全面地看待網路並制定最佳實踐來應對新的安全威脅。 5G的出現將為網路即服務解決方案供應商提供提高網路成本效率的巨大機會。在通訊產業,網路自動化程度的提高和其他技術的整合正在推動對 5G 的需求。
  • 據 GSMA 稱,預計北美 5G 普及速度將在短期內放緩,且預測結果將根據 COVID-19 疫情的影響進行修改。然而,與 COVID-19 先前的預測相比,2023 年至 2025 年間,5G 使用量預計將增加 1,300 萬個連線。

預計美國將佔較大市場佔有率

  • 美國是一個已開發經濟體,非常傾向於採用和接受先進技術、發展網路自動化以及普及雲端基礎的服務,為安全接入服務邊際市場做出了貢獻。此外,終端用戶產業數位化的提高以及思科系統公司 (Cisco Systems Inc.)、威睿公司 (Vmware Inc.)、Palo Alto Networks、Versa Networks Inc. 和 Akamai Technologies 等知名供應商的出現也促進了市場的成長。
  • 此外,隨著企業數位轉型快速加速,安全性也擴大轉移到雲端。此外,隨著終端用戶產業大量採用雲端服務,需要保護網路基礎架構並降低複雜性以提高速度和靈活性。預計這將為未來幾年的市場供應商提供巨大的成長機會。
  • 根據交付模式,網路即服務(NaaS)領域預計將在未來幾年在美國見證顯著成長。由於雲端解決方案在各行業的滲透、物聯網和工業 4.0 的出現以及 DDoS 和資料外洩的增加,預計市場將大幅成長。所有這些因素預計將推動美國對網路即服務 (NaaS) 的需求。根據GSMA預測,到2025年,北美工業物聯網(IoT)和消費者連線數量預計將成長至約54億。
  • 此外,該國有三大雲端服務供應商:亞馬遜網路服務、微軟的 Azure 和谷歌雲端。它也被認為是 5G、自動駕駛、物聯網、區塊鏈、人工智慧和遊戲等重大技術創新的中心。整合 SASE 功能可以將零信任安全功能整合到企業架構中,這對於實現可信任的網路安全態勢至關重要。透過這種方式,SASE 解決方案有望改變最終用戶網路和安全架構,降低網路風險、成本和複雜性。
  • 市場上的供應商正在利用這一機會並推出創新的 SASE 解決方案,以透過 SASE 解決方案增強網路彈性。例如,2023 年 4 月,埃森哲與 Palo Alto Networks 聯合上市了由 Palo Alto Networks 基於 AI 的 Prisma SASE 提供支援的安全存取服務邊際(SASE) 解決方案。該解決方案使企業能夠提高其網路彈性並加快其業務轉型努力。

北美安全存取服務邊際產業概覽

北美安全接入服務邊際市場主要參與者包括思科系統公司、VMware 公司、Fortinet 公司、Akamai 技術公司和 Zscaler 公司。該市場的參與企業正在採取合作和收購等策略來加強其產品供應並獲得永續的競爭優勢。

  • 2024 年 4 月,CloudCover 與 SHI International夥伴關係,擴大其進階威脅預防網路安全平台的全球影響力。 SHI 是端到端 IT 解決方案的全球領導者,擁有無與倫比的供應鏈,並提供 CloudCover 專有的 XDR/SASE(安全即服務)平台作為其安全產品組合的一部分。 CloudCover 提供先進的網路風險管理,提供微秒的風險感知和控制。此外,我們正在建立一個包含責任保護方法的網路內網路安全保險系統。
  • 2024 年 1 月,技術基礎設施服務供應商Kyndryl 與思科合作推出了兩項先進的保全服務。這些服務旨在為客戶提供更好的安全控制並能夠主動應對網路事件。新服務-採用思科安全存取的 Kyndryl Consult Security Services Edge (SSE) 以及採用思科安全存取的 Kyndryl Managed SSE,代表了網路安全解決方案的重大發展。
  • 2023 年 8 月,由 AI/ML 提供支援的統一安全存取服務邊際(SASE) 的全球供應商 Versa Networks 宣布對 VersaAI 進行一系列增強,包括新的嵌入式產生 AI 功能(可即時識別惡意行為)、安全的生成 AI 工具,以及增強的網路和安全營運績效。

The North America Secure Access Service Edge Market size is estimated at USD 11.63 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ach USD 29.08 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 20.12% during the forecast period (2025-2030).

North America Secure Access Service Edge - Market - IMG1

Demand for qualified individuals to implement, manage, and support SASE solutions increases as SASE adoption spreads. As a result, the number of training and certification programs provided by vendors and independent groups has increased. To enable the efficient deployment and use of these technologies, IT teams are concentrating on gaining competence in SASE.

Key Highlights

  • SASE helps enterprises achieve strict compliance requirements by enforcing uniform security standards and encryption across the network. It minimizes the chances of regulatory infractions and related fines by safeguarding data during transmission and when kept in cloud applications. For instance, a healthcare institution is expected to abide by stringent regulatory standards for protecting patient data, including safeguarding data during information and idle state.
  • The use of SASE is strongly encouraged by the shortage of sufficient security protocols and technologies. An all-encompassing and adaptable security solution like SASE is becoming increasingly necessary for organizations dealing with an expanding threat landscape, remote work issues, cloud migrations, and compliance obligations. In addition to addressing these urgent security issues, it closes the cybersecurity talent gap and guarantees scalability, business continuity, and resilience in the face of contemporary threats and difficulties.
  • The mandatory observance of data privacy and regulatory legislation is a strong force behind expanding the SASE business. Businesses are realizing the necessity of a complete security solution like SASE to assist them in complying with strict data protection rules, avoiding penalties, and safeguarding their brand. The demand for SASE as a tool for assuring compliance is anticipated to grow as privacy legislation continues to change and spread internationally, making it an essential part of contemporary cybersecurity and data protection initiatives.
  • The demand for cloud-based solutions surges due to the growing technological advances and consumer propensity toward the cloud. Technology allows the user to access data from remote locations. The increasing realization among companies about the cost and resource efficiency of shifting data to the cloud rather than maintaining on-premise infrastructure is driving the demand for cloud-based solutions among enterprises.
  • The COVID-19 pandemic accelerated the enterprise's SASE adoption as digital transformation initiatives advanced rapidly. As cloud adoption continues to accelerate through the convergence of networking, security is critical to better support an increasingly remote and mobile workforce.
  • In March 2023, Fortinet, the global cybersecurity firm driving the convergence of networking and security, announced several enhancements to FortiSASE, Fortinet's single-vendor SASE solution, enabling additional deployment flexibility and new secure access capabilities for digital resources across SaaS, private applications, and the internet.

North America Secure Access Service Edge Market Trends

IT and Telecom End-user Industry is Expected to Hold Significant Market Share

  • North America, particularly the United States, is often a major player in the IT and telecom sectors. The region boasts a robust telecommunications industry, numerous technology companies, and significant investment in IT infrastructure. For instance, in May 2023, Kyndryl, a US-based supplier of IT infrastructure services, introduced a managed secure access service edge (SASE) solution powered by Fortinet that intends to assist clients in implementing advanced network security measures. The solution combines Kyndryl's network and security services with Fortinet's cloud-delivered security and secure networking solutions to design, construct, maintain, and upgrade mission-critical networking for clients across sectors. Such initiatives led to substantial adoption of SASE solutions in the IT and telecom end-user vertical.
  • Moreover, network-as-a-service (NaaS) is essential for IT and telecom organizations because it provides the network infrastructure necessary for seamless communication, data transfer, and cloud connectivity. These organizations rely heavily on robust and scalable networking solutions. For instance, in July 2023, Lumen Technologies, a US-based telecom company, introduced its flagship feature on its network-as-a-service (NaaS) platform as a part of its plan to transform the telecom sector. Lumen is transforming traditional telecom into the cloud by giving consumers flexibility in purchasing, utilizing, and managing networking services.
  • Overall, the IT and telecom end-user vertical growth in the SASE market is driven by the sector's specific cybersecurity needs, the imperative for secure remote access, the protection of telecommunications services, and the broader trends of digital transformation and cloud adoption.
  • 5G's revolutionary latency, throughput, and reliability capabilities will support new industrial, business, and consumer services. It will encourage the global SASE vendors to embrace a more holistic view of the network and develop best practices to combat new security threats. Network as a service solution provider will get more lucrative opportunities to improve the network's cost efficiency with the advent of 5G. The rising integration of network automation and other technologies in the telecom industry is increasing the demand for 5G.
  • According to GSMA, the forecasts revised for the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ic expect a short-term slowdown in using 5G in North America. However, from 2023 to 2025, the 5G take-up is expected to account for 13 million more connections compared to the pre-COVID-19 forecast.

United States is Expected to Hold Significant Market Share

  • The United States is a developed economy with a significant inclination toward implementing and accepting advanced technology, development in network automation, and surge in cloud-based services, thereby contributing to the secure access service edge market. Moreover, the growing digitization among end-user industries, coupled with the presence of prominent market vendors like Cisco Systems Inc., Vmware Inc., Palo Alto Networks, Versa Networks Inc., and Akamai Technologies, contribute to the market's growth.
  • Further, security is moving to the cloud with the rapid acceleration of the digital transformation of businesses. Additionally, the significant adoption of cloud services in the end-user industries necessitates securing the network infrastructure and reducing complexity to improve speed and agility. This is analyzed to create substantial growth opportunities for market vendors in the coming years.
  • By offering type, the network-as-a-service segment is analyzed to witness substantial growth in the United States over the coming years. The market is expected to grow significantly, owing to the greater penetration of cloud solutions across various industry verticals, the advent of IoT and Industry 4.0, and the growing number of DDoS and data breaches. All these factors are expected to drive the demand for network-as-a-service offerings in the United States. According to GSMA, in North America, by 2025, the number of industrial Internet of Things (IoT) and consumer connections is expected to increase to about 5.4 billion.
  • Further, the country has three major cloud service providers: Amazon Web Services, Microsoft's Azure, and Google Cloud. It is also considered the hub for major technological innovations such as 5G, autonomous driving, IoT, blockchain, artificial intelligence, and gaming. Integrating SASE capabilities converges zero trust security capabilities into enterprise architectures, which is paramount in achieving a trusted network security posture. Thus, SASE solutions are analyzed to transform the end-user's network and security architecture to reduce cyber risk, costs, and complexity.
  • Market vendors are capitalizing on the opportunity and launching innovative SASE solutions to enhance cyber resiliency through SASE solutions. For instance, in April 2023, Accenture and Palo Alto Networks collaborated to deliver joint secure access service edge (SASE) solutions powered by the Palo Alto Networks AI-powered Prisma SASE. The solution will enable organizations to improve cyber resilience and accelerate business transformation efforts.

North America Secure Access Service Edge Industry Overview

The North American secure access service edge market is fragmented with the presence of major players like Cisco Systems Inc., VMware Inc., Fortinet Inc., Akamai Technologies Inc., and Zscaler Inc. Players in the market are adopting strategies such as partnerships and acquisitions to enhance their product offerings and gain sustainable competitive advantage.

  • April 2024: CloudCover formed a partnership with SHI International to extend the global reach of its advanced threat-prevention cybersecurity platform. SHI, a global leader in end-to-end IT solutions with an unparalleled supply chain, offers CloudCover's unique XDR/SASE security-as-a-service platform as part of its security portfolio. CloudCover delivers advanced cyber risk management, providing microsecond risk awareness and control. Additionally, it has established an in-network cybersecurity insurance system with methods that embed liability protection.
  • January 2024: Kyndryl, a technology infrastructure services provider, introduced two advanced security services in partnership with Cisco. These services aim to enhance customers' security controls and enable proactive responses to cyber incidents. The new offerings, Kyndryl Consult Security Services Edge (SSE) with Cisco Secure Access and Kyndryl Managed SSE with Cisco Secure Access, represent a significant advancement in cybersecurity solutions.
  • August 2023 - Versa Networks, the global provider in AI/ML powered Unified Secure Access Service Edge (SASE), announced a set of enhancements to VersaAI that includes new embedded generative AI capabilities to identify malicious behaviors in real-time, secure generative AI tools, and enhance network and security operational excellence.
